Most people think that everyone would love to work at home but in reality, work at home is not for everyone. Of course a working at home has many advantages, but never forgets the inconvenience involved.

People feign for the freedom, making their own hours, sleeping in, no more commuting, you can take a day off whenever you want, you don’t have to deal with co workers, and being your own boss.

All this sounds good, doesn’t it? On the other hand, it is a great responsibility and very few are able to simply close shop at 6pm for the night as they can in a brick and mortar job.

You do not work all hours and you do not make a designated amount of money. Many like the idea of working at home so they can be with their families, but remember the old adage, “Be careful what you ask for.”

You have to be able to truly balance dual roles of being a productive worker and being a parent. You must be able to set firm boundaries and make sure you a running your business as efficient as possible.

Balance will be both your best friend and your worst enemy. When you work at home, it means you are independent. Self-employment is often reflected by some as one who is unemployed unless you are an entrepreneur.

Many people see home workers as simply staying home. You must be able to cope with these obstacles and overcome them. There will be unexpected guests who think that because you’re home, it is time to socialize.

You may find the phone ringing off the hook just because you are home, so you must be available to chat. You don’t want to be rude but sometimes it takes a hammer on the head for people to understand.

Put a note on your door you that says you are not available 8-5 and either get a phone line or send all calls to voice mail and check them later.

With your work happening at home, it is a must to find a good work space where you will operate. You have to see the way your office space will interact with all aspects of your family life. You will want to get away from all the diversions, to help you access the necessary amount of effort for your home based business.

Businesses are looking for people to handle their book keeping needs, and are more than happy if you can do it from home. All of you who have good language skills could be well suited for translating documents, in which you will help companies that need this type of work done. With medical claims examining, you ensure that care providers fill out their billing forms properly, So the insurance companies will pay them.

You might need some kind of permit to be in accordance with the local laws. Get a permit (it will cost something) if need be. Once you have this business license, the zoning commission will inquire about any zoning issues for using your house as a place of business. If you have a zoning problem, your following move is to obtain a variance. This variance will nullify the zoning law, and make it okay to operate your business.

You will be working for yourself. Financing your business will be critical in succeeding in your venture. Inexperienced first timers don’t accurately measure what things will cost. You want to calculate the cost of everything before you find yourself unable to continue your dream. Plan to have the monies you need to give the business opportunity a chance to succeed. Be prepared and plan wisely until profits are strong. Probably the wisest move you can do is stay at your present job and operate your home base business on a part time basis, until you don’t need that original job.
